ما هو الملف التالف وكيف يمكنني إصلاحه؟

تلف الملف(File) هو شكل من أشكال التلف العرضي أو غير المقصود للبيانات الموجودة في ملف. يأتي تلف الملفات(File) بأشكال عديدة ويحدث لأسباب مختلفة ، لكن النتيجة واحدة: لا يمكنك قراءة بياناتك.

في بعض الحالات ، يمكنك عكس تلف الملف أو إصلاحه ، لكن هذا ليس ممكنًا دائمًا. من الأفضل أن تفهم سبب حدوث الفساد وكيف يمكنك الحماية منه.

ماذا يعني (Mean)تلف(Files) الملفات ؟

"الملف" هو مجموعة من البيانات ذات الصلة التي يجب قراءتها كوحدة ، مكتوبة بتنسيق ملف معين. على سبيل المثال ، ترتبط جميع البيانات الموجودة في ملف Microsoft Office (Microsoft Office Word)Word بمستند Word الذي قمت بإنشائه وتخزينه بتنسيق ملف docx . إذا أصبح نصف الملف غير قابل للقراءة فجأة ، فلن تتمكن على الأرجح من فتح المستند. حتى لو استطعت ، فستفقد الكثير من المعلومات. وبالمثل(Likewise) ، فإن جدول بيانات Excel بقيم عشوائية مفقودة أو تم تغييرها لن يكون ذا قيمة.

يتكون أي ملف كمبيوتر من رمز ثنائي. إنها سلسلة من الآحاد والأصفار مجمعة في مجموعات من البتات ، والتي تمثل بيانات مثل حرف.

في كود ASCII ، يتم تمثيل الحرف "A" بالرمز الثنائي 01000001. إذا قمنا بتغيير بت واحد ، مثل آخر 1 إلى 0 ، فإن الحرف "A" يصبح "@"!

هذه هي الطريقة التي يعمل بها الفساد على المستوى الأساسي. يتم تغيير قيم وحدات البت داخل الملف أو مسحها ، مما يؤدي إلى ملف غير قابل للقراءة أو يمكن قراءته جزئيًا فقط.

كيف تتحقق من حدوث تلف في الملف(File Corruption Has)

يمكن أن يكون لتلف الملفات أعراض مختلفة ، اعتمادًا على الملفات التي تم إتلافها ومدى أهميتها.

أخطاء CRC(CRC Errors)

التحقق الدوري من التكرار(Redundancy Check) ( CRC ) يتحقق مما إذا كان الملف كاملاً ومخزنًا بشكل صحيح. تطبق CRCs(CRCs) صيغة على البيانات الموجودة في الملف الأصلي الأصلي ، مما ينتج عنه رقم كإخراج. إذا قمت بتطبيق نفس الصيغة على أي نسخة من هذا الملف ، فيجب أن يكون هذا الرقم هو نفسه. إذا كان الرقم مختلفًا ، فأنت تتعامل مع ملف تالف أو تم تغييره.

غالبًا ما ترى هذا الخطأ عند محاولة نسخ البيانات من قرص ضوئي تالف أو محرك أقراص ثابت محتضر ، ولكن العديد من التطبيقات يمكن أن تعطي خطأ CRC عندما يتحققون ذاتيًا من ملفاتهم مقابل جدول القيم الصحيحة.

أخطاء فتح الملف(File Opening Errors)

إذا كان الملف تالفًا ، فإما أنه لن يفتح أو سيتم فتحه بنتائج مشوهة. يتم دفق بعض أنواع الملفات وتتسامح إلى حد ما مع الضرر. على سبيل المثال ، إذا كان لديك ملف فيديو به بعض التلف ، فقد تعرض تطبيقات مشغل الوسائط صورة مفككة أو متعثرة ، ولكن بخلاف ذلك ، قم بتشغيل الملف بأكمله.

يجب أن تكون الأنواع الأخرى من الملفات ، مثل البرامج التنفيذية ، كاملة بنسبة 100٪ ، وإلا فلن يبدأ البرنامج.

وأنواع الملفات الأخرى ، مثل المستندات التي قمت بإنشائها ، قد تفتح ولكنها تفتقد إلى معلومات حيوية ، مثل القيم الفعلية من المستند أو التنسيق. 

سلوكيات غريبة ومواطن الخلل(Strange Behaviors and Glitches)

عندما تتلف ملفات الموارد أو الإعدادات التي يحتاجها التطبيق ، فقد تظهر بمهارة أكبر. لن يفشل البرنامج بالضرورة في البدء ، ولكن بعض المكونات الفرعية التي تعتمد على هذه الملفات قد تسبب أخطاء أو لا تفعل شيئًا أو تعطل التطبيق بأكمله.

أعطال النظام وعدم استقراره(System Crashes and Instability)

عندما تحصل على ملفات نظام تالفة ، يمكن أن تؤثر بشكل أساسي على جهاز الكمبيوتر الخاص بك. قد تحصل بشكل مفاجئ على شاشة الموت الزرقاء (شاشة الموت (Death)الزرقاء(BSODs) ) بشكل(Blue Screen) مفاجئ بشكل عشوائي أو لديك نظام معلق أو لا يعمل بالطريقة التي من المفترض أن يعمل بها. يعد تلف الملفات الحرج(Critical) من هذا النوع هو الأكثر تدميراً ويمكن أن يشير غالبًا إلى مشكلة خطيرة في أجهزتك في كثير من الحالات.

لماذا يحدث ملف الفساد؟

الآن نحن نعرف ما هو الفساد ، ولكن كيف يحدث؟ 

على الرغم من أن الفساد هو مجرد تغيير في قيم البت بطريقة فوضوية ومدمرة ، إلا أن أسباب هذه القيم المتغيرة تختلف كثيرًا. هذا بشكل أساسي لأن وسائط الكمبيوتر تأتي في العديد من الأشكال المختلفة وتخزن الأرقام الثنائية بطرق مختلفة جدًا.

فقدان الطاقة المفاجئ(Sudden Power Loss)

أحد الأسباب الأكثر شيوعًا لتعرض جهاز التخزين لتلف الملفات هو انقطاع التيار الكهربائي المفاجئ. هذا ينطبق بشكل خاص على محركات الأقراص الصلبة الميكانيكية ، حيث يمكن أن يؤدي قطع الطاقة أثناء الكتابة إلى القرص إلى مسح البيانات. في الماضي ، كان من الممكن أن يصطدم رأس القراءة / الكتابة للقرص بالطبق إذا فقد الطاقة ، ولكن لا يزال بإمكان محركات الأقراص الحديثة "إيقاف" رؤوسهم بأمان حتى عند انقطاع التيار الكهربائي فجأة.

هذا لا يعني أن محركات الأقراص الميكانيكية أو ذات الحالة الصلبة تكون منيعة ضد الفساد من خلال فقدان البيانات. إذا كان محرك الأقراص يقوم بكتابة البيانات بشكل نشط عند انقطاع التيار الكهربائي ، فقد يكون جزء فقط من الملف قد وصل إلى القرص. يستخدم كلا النوعين من محركات الأقراص ذاكرة التخزين المؤقت المتغيرة. هذا يعني فقدان البيانات الموجودة بداخلها في حالة انقطاع التيار الكهربائي.

فشل في الأجهزة(Hardware Failure)

جميع وسائط التخزين لها عمر افتراضي محدود. يمكن أن تبلى أو تبدأ في التعطل. في بعض الأحيان ، يحدث هذا الفشل ببطء مع مرور الوقت ، وأحيانًا يكون مفاجئًا. يعرف أي شخص تعامل مع الأقراص الصلبة الميكانيكية "نقرة الموت" المخيفة التي تصنعها العديد من محركات الأقراص قبل أن يموت بعد فترة قصيرة.

إنها ليست مجرد محركات أقراص صلبة أيضًا. يمكن أن تتسبب ذاكرة الوصول العشوائي الخاطئة(Faulty RAM) في تلف البيانات حيث تتم كتابة القيم الخاطئة على القرص ، ويمكن أن تكون الأقراص الضوئية المخدوشة غير قابلة للقراءة بفضل التلف المادي ، وما إلى ذلك.

البرمجيات الخبيثة(Malware)

تشمل البرامج الضارة(Malware) أي برامج مكتوبة بقصد ضار متعمد. يمكن أن يكون تلف البيانات(Data) أو تدميرها الناتج عن الإصابة بالبرامج الضارة عن طريق التصميم أو عن طريق الصدفة. لا يمتلك مؤلفو البرامج الضارة(Malware) الكثير من الدوافع لتدمير بياناتك في الغالب. بدلاً من ذلك ، سيحتجزونها رهينة المال (برامج الفدية) أو يسرقونها لبيعها في السوق السوداء.

في بعض الحالات ، تتم كتابة البرامج الضارة ببساطة لنشر الفوضى والدمار. عادةً ما تقوم البرامج الضارة(Malware) المصممة لإتلاف البيانات أو تدميرها بطريقة يستحيل استردادها فعليًا.

منع وعكس الفساد في الملفات(File)

من الأفضل دائمًا منع الفساد من التأثير عليك في المقام الأول ، ولكن هناك أيضًا طرق لعكسه في بعض الحالات.

تحقق من الأقراص بحثًا عن أخطاء(Check Disks for Errors)

يمكنك استخدام العديد من الأدوات المساعدة من Microsoft Windows والجهات الخارجية للتحقق من الأخطاء الحالية مثل القطاعات التالفة على محركات الأقراص الخاصة بك. يمكنك أيضًا استخدام الأدوات المساعدة لتشخيص سجلات تشغيل محرك الأقراص للتنبؤ بما إذا كان الفشل وشيكًا ، مما يمنحك الوقت لنقل تلك البيانات إلى مكان آخر.

تحقق من كيفية فحص محرك الأقراص الثابتة بحثًا عن أخطاء(How to Check Your Hard Drive for Errors) للحصول على إرشادات مفصلة.

عمل نسخ احتياطية متكررة(Make Frequent Backups)

يصف " النسخ(Backing) الاحتياطي" للبيانات مجموعة متنوعة من الممارسات. يتضمن ذلك استنساخ محرك الأقراص بالكامل في حالة تعطله ، وإنشاء أرشيفات ملفات ZIP ، ونسخ ملفات معينة احتياطيًا إلى السحابة ، وعمل نسخ احتياطية تدريجية تلقائيًا على محرك أقراص خارجي ، والمزيد. إذا كان لديك نسخ احتياطية حديثة من البيانات ، فإن الفساد يصبح مصدر إزعاج وليس كارثة.

إذا كنت تريد معرفة المزيد عن عمل النسخ الاحتياطية ، فلدينا العديد من الأدلة القيمة:

يجب أن تقوم بتغطية هذه النسخ الاحتياطية على أنظمة Windows الحديثة ، ولكن يمكن لمستخدمي macOS الاطلاع على دليل Time Machine(Time Machine guide) الخاص بنا .

كإجراء وقائي إضافي ، يمكنك أيضًا إنشاء نقطة استعادة النظام يدويًا(manually create a System Restore point) للرجوع إلى إصدار سابق من تثبيت Windows قبل تغييرات الملف المدمرة التي لا تتعلق بفشل الأجهزة.

استخدم ميزات التحقق من الملفات(Use File Verification Features)

يمكن لبعض عملاء البرامج أيضًا تشغيل عمليات التحقق من الملفات. على سبيل المثال ، يمكن لعميل ألعاب الفيديو Steam التحقق مما إذا كانت ملفات اللعبة قد تم تغييرها(check whether a game’s files have been altered) واستعادة البيانات الأصلية من نسخة رئيسية عبر الإنترنت.

إخراج محركات الأقراص قبل إزالتها(Eject Drives Before Removing Them)

بغض النظر عن نوع القرص أو نظام التشغيل ، يجب إخراج محركات الأقراص قبل فصلها. على الأقل ، انتظر حتى يتوقف ضوء نشاط القرص قبل فصله ، ولكن من الناحية المثالية ، خذ ثانية أو ثانيتين لإخراج محرك أقراص فلاش أو قرص ثابت خارجي.

استخدم برنامج مكافحة الفيروسات(Use Antivirus Software)

إذا كنت لا تريد الفساد المرتبط بالبرامج الضارة ، فاستخدم برامج مكافحة الفيروسات. هناك العديد من الخيارات لأنظمة Windows و macOS و Linux .

استخدم مدقق ملفات النظام (SFC)(Use the System File Checker (SFC))

في بعض الحالات ، يمكنك تحديد ما إذا كان قد حدث تلف لملفاتك وإصلاحها(and ) تلقائيًا. يحتوي Windows(Windows) على العديد من أدوات إصلاح الملفات لإصلاح ملفات نظام Windows التالفة ، مثل System File Checker . يمكنك الحصول على التفاصيل الدقيقة في دليلنا لاستخدام أوامر موجه الأوامر لإصلاح أو إصلاح الملفات(Using the Command Prompt Commands to Fix or Repair Corrupt Files) التالفة ، والذي يغطي أيضًا أداة ( tool)DISM وأمر SCANNOW . قد ترغب أيضًا في تجربة الأمر CHKDSK لاكتشاف أخطاء محرك الأقراص.

الدفع لاستعادة البيانات(Pay For Data Recovery)

يتمثل الملاذ الأخير في الحصول على برنامج متخصص لاستعادة الملفات (يتم دفعه دائمًا تقريبًا) أو استئجار شركة لاستعادة البيانات لإعادة بناء أكبر قدر ممكن من بياناتك. هذا مكلف للغاية ويستحق القيام به فقط إذا تجاوزت قيمة البيانات تكلفة الاسترداد. لذلك عادة ما يستحق الأمر استكشاف الأخطاء وإصلاحها قبل سحب بطاقة الائتمان الخاصة بك لشراء برنامج إصلاح الملفات.

إذا لم تكن قد تعرضت لتلف البيانات ، فلم يفت الأوان لتطبيق بعض الإجراءات الوقائية التي ذكرناها أعلاه. حتى لو كان ذلك لبياناتك الأكثر قيمة والتي لا يمكن الاستغناء عنها.



About the author

أنا مبرمج كمبيوتر منذ أكثر من 15 عامًا. تكمن مهاراتي في تطوير التطبيقات البرمجية وصيانتها ، فضلاً عن تقديم الدعم الفني لتلك التطبيقات. لقد قمت أيضًا بتدريس برمجة الكمبيوتر لطلاب المدارس الثانوية ، وأنا حاليًا مدرس محترف.



Related posts